How Formula 1 Betting Works 

F1 betting is not the same as cricket betting. Here you must think about car set-up, tyres, weather, pit stops, safety car, and even the track layout. Start with these common markets:

  • Race Winner: pick who wins the Grand Prix.
  • Podium Finish (Top 3): your driver must finish P1–P3.
  • Points Finish (Top 10): safer than podium, but odds are lower.
  • Fastest Lap: the driver with the fastest single lap in the race.
  • Head-to-Head (Driver vs Driver): which of two drivers ends higher.
  • Qualifying Winner / Pole: who starts P1 on Sunday.
  • Season (Outright) Bets: Drivers’ Champion or Constructors’ Champion.

Smart F1 Betting Tips (easy and practical)

  • Track first: some tracks are “power tracks,” others need high downforce. Check last 3–5 years results on formula1.com.
  • Tyres: soft vs hard matters a lot. Read Pirelli notes: Pirelli F1.
  • Weather: rain can flip the grid. If rain risk is high, consider points finish or H2H instead of race winner.
  • Quali pace vs race pace: some teams are better on Saturday than Sunday. Balance your bets.
  • Safety car odds: some circuits have frequent safety cars. Live markets can shift fast—plan entry and exit.
  • Bankroll: stake small (e.g., 1–2% of bankroll per bet). Take breaks.

Bonuses and Promos (what really matters)

Promos sound great, but read the small print. Focus on:

  • Wagering: lower is better (e.g., 5–10× is far better than 30–40×).
  • Min odds: check if your F1 line meets the required odds.
  • Expiry: many bonuses expire in 7–14 days.
  • Max win / stake caps: see if there is a limit on bonus wins.

Some sites offer extra free bets or cashback on Grand Prix weekends. Compare offers and only take a bonus if it fits your plan.
